How Is Lombok Coffee Grown in the Rinjani Highlands? 

Lombok’s coffee-growing regions are concentrated around the Rinjani Geopark, an active volcanic zone in the island’s interior. The mountain’s volcanic activity enriches the soil with minerals that support plant health and flavor development.

The Arabica-producing regions of Sembalun, Sajang, and Sapit sit in East Lombok at elevations between 800 and 1,156 meters above sea level.

Robusta is primarily grown in North Lombok, with the Gangga District as its core production area. The villages of Rempek, Genggelang, and Selelos lie on the west slopes of Mount Rinjani at elevations between 450 and 850 meters above sea level. The total plantation potential is around 2,000 hectares.

Coffee is also grown in West Lombok, Central Lombok, and Mataram. Most farms here use intercropping, planting coffee alongside fruit trees and spices.

Several factors influence the quality and character of Lombok highland coffee:

  • Altitude slows down cherry ripening, helping the beans develop a more defined structure and flavor.
  • Volcanic soil adds balance and clarity to the cup, giving Lombok coffee its clean profile.
  • A stable highland climate supports a consistent growing cycle, helping maintain quality year to year.
  • Concentrated production areas make it easier to control procurement and trace the coffee’s origin.

Farmers in these regions apply sustainable land management practices, including composting coffee husk waste to maintain soil health. They also choose specific seeds, helping their coffee plants stay resilient and productive year after year.

These unique growing conditions influence the character of Lombok coffee after harvest, resulting in beans that remain consistent through processing and offer reliable results during roasting.

Lombok Coffee Compared to Other Indonesian Origins

Fresh coffee cherries held by hand, representing the early stage of coffee cultivation in Indonesia.

Lombok coffee offers a distinct character that sets it apart from other Indonesian coffees, particularly the heavier, earthier profiles associated with Sumatra.

Arabica lots from the Rinjani highlands region of Sembalun have achieved scores in the 82.25 range in physical and sensory evaluations. Rated as ‘Grade Excellent’ in professional assessment. Its smooth flavor, balanced acidity, and rich aroma make it a standout choice.

Lombok highland Arabica is a reliable choice for roasters looking for Indonesian coffee that excels in lighter roasts or modern profiles. It also serves well as a complementary origin, adding contrast and brightness when blended with more intense Indonesian coffees.

Sembalun Village, as one of the few areas on Lombok with the specific cool highland climate required for Arabica, is a notable point of origin within this broader picture.

Many domestic and international tourists pass through Sembalun on their way to Mount Rinjani. The local community uses this opportunity to promote both their coffee and agrotourism, sharing the story of Lombok coffee’s origins at local coffee shops and farms.

Where Is the Lombok Coffee Plantation Located?

Lombok’s Arabica coffee plantations are located in the highland zones of East Lombok at elevations between 800 and 1,156 meters above sea level, supported by volcanic soil from Mount Rinjani and a stable, cool highland climate. Robusta is grown in North Lombok at lower elevations. North Lombok plantations are generally more productive, having been rejuvenated within the last 10 to 15 years.
